<strong>iReport</strong> <strong>Ultimate</strong> <strong>Guide</strong>Figure 9-5classicC.jrxml reportThe Column Header band is hidden because this is a columnar report and the band is not useful, while in the Detail band thereare static text labels and textfields. Some elements (like the one in the title that shows the template name or the one in the pagefooter that shows the page number) are ignored by the wizard which will not modify them. As well, there are some labels andtextfields which contain a special keyword as text. These will be used by the wizard as templates to create new fields orpopulated with proper expressions to show specific data. Here are the rules to follow to specify how the wizard will work withthese elements.And here is the corresponding tabular report format.Figure 9-6classicT.jrxml report9.2 GroupsWe have said the wizard uses up to four groups. They are used in order from first last, respecting the group order defined in thereport. For example. if the user decides to group the data by COUNTRY, and this is the only group requested, the wizard willuse only Group1 (the one that is all black in the illustration 5). If the user decides to have to levels of group, let’s sayCOUNTRY and CITY, the wizard will use Group1 for the COUNTRY and the nested Group2 for the CITY.The group header and footer can contain any arbitrary element.142
